Virtually all the sources I can find claim that the intervals between adjacent guitar strings in standard tuning (EADGBE) should be perfect fourths, except for one major third. However, since a perfect fourth is 4/3 and a major third is 5/4, this means the interval between the two E strings would be (4/3)**4 * (5/4) = 3.950... which is about ... 42 argo street south yarra WebOct 1, 2024 · 5 different sounds. Song Title. 42 arkenstone way leppington WebJul 27, 2006 · Putting an EADGC set on will have less tension on the neck since they're thinner strings. No, not necessarily. In fact, the E string, when tuned to pitch, is likely to have more tension than most Bs, when tuned to pitch. Thinner strings only have less tension *if tuned to the same pitch*.
WebTo be exact, from low to high, standard guitar tuning is EADGBE—three intervals of a fourth (low E to A, A to D and D to G), followed by a major third (G to B), followed by one more fourth (B to the high E).
